Patch available for Red Hat wu-ftpd buffer overflow exploit. Upgrade to prevent unauthorized access.
Buffer overflow in wu-ftpd 2.6.0 and below fixed

Solution

For each RPM for your particular architecture, run:

rpm -Fvh [filename]

where filename is the name of the RPM.

These packages are GPG signed by Red Hat, Inc. for security. Our key is available at:

You can verify each package with the following command: rpm --checksig

If you only wish to verify that each package has not been corrupted or tampered with, examine only the md5sum with the following command: rpm --checksig --nogpg
